Keller Leads The Way In Ocean Super Modified Action

WATSONVILLE, Calif. — K.C. Keller prevailed over a strong field of IMCA Sport Modifieds to claim Friday’s 20-lap feature at Ocean Speedway.

Keller was one of five race winners during the night at the Santa Cruz County Fairgrounds Dirt Track.

“I had a little baby girl in February, she’s five months old now. It was going to be kind of a lot (to keep racing),” Keller said. “But my son has taken a huge interest this year. So we took the car off the market and as long as he’s going with me and the rest family, we’re going to keep going.”

Keller snagged the pole position against a 19-car starting grid. The first caution fell on lap five when Brian Baggett spun in turn two. On the restart, Steven Allee back pedaled a bit from second to fourth. Bo Crebs crashed in turn four with front end up damage for the next caution on lap seven. Cody Bryan pitted with a right front flat tire as well.

Matt Hagio and Rob Gallaher, the fourth row starters, went head-to-head in a back and forth battle for second. After a pair of cautions for spins, Hagio was clear of Gallaher and turned his attention on Keller. The leaders approached traffic on lap 15 and the lead shrunk to one car length. A caution on lap 16 for Atascadero’s Matthew Pwtorak spinning changed the game.

Keller used the free real estate ahead of him to dart away for the win. Hagio settled for second over Gallaher, Allee, and Jeff Mead.

2020 IMCA Sport Modified champion Adriane Frost earned her third Hobby Stock feature win of the season in a 20-lap contest. Shawn Jones dominated a non-stop 20-lap South Bay Dwarf Car feature.

Amaya Flower scored her second Four Banger feature win of the season in a non-stop, wire-to-wire performance. Jerry Ogg of Santa Clara Police Department won his first 15-lap Police-in-Pursuit for Special Olympics feature of the season.
